When a business decides to provide access to analytics for its team members, it must incorporate the consideration of mobile access into its project plan. Without mobile access to data, it is difficult to implement strategies for Citizen Data Scientists or initiatives for Digital Transformation (Dx), data literacy or data democratization. Every team member expects to have mobile access to tools and information in order to perform tasks and fulfill their role.

Here are just a few of the considerations your business should include to ensure that it selects the right mobile augmented analytics application:

• Be sure the app is designed for seamless user interface as a cross-platform, hybrid mobile app that is available for both iOS and Android.

• Ensure that the app is truly mobile and not just a desktop app that provides access but offers less than optimal navigation and user experience.

• Review training requirements to ensure that your team members can quickly adopt and use the app without extensive training.

• Ask about support and implementation requirements to ensure that your team will not be mired in complex implementation, upgrade and support tasks.

• Ensure appropriate security and privacy methodologies and processes.

• Look for flexible hosting – on premises, public or private cloud.

• Start-up should take minutes (not weeks).

• Be sure your users will have access to easy-to-use augmented analytics tools, e.g., dashboards, reports, clickless analytics with natural language processing (NLP) search analytics and sophisticated functionality that allows for easy access and clear, concise reporting without data scientist skills or IT assistance.
